A few days ago, the number of domestic corrugated board manufacturers continued to increase, and corrugated board production technology also continued to improve, but how to ensure that corrugated board (box) is protected from the environment (moisture) is still facing many problems.
We know that the moisture content of corrugated cardboard is one of the important indicators of corrugated cardboard, which directly determines the quality of corrugated cardboard produced. Corrugated cardboard is made of fiber base paper and is greatly affected by environmental factors. Therefore, the biggest technical problem of corrugated cardboard packaging is that it is difficult to resist moisture and moisture. In transportation and storage, the environment with high humidity will absorb moisture and reduce the strength, which will cause the loss of the function of the corrugated box and cause damage to the product. In a high-temperature and dry environment, the corrugated cardboard will be dry and dry after the moisture drops to a certain level. Folding resistance is reduced, and finally the carton flap is broken. Therefore, the biggest defect of corrugated cardboard material is brittleness when drying, and the strength is reduced when high humidity. Therefore, how to control the moisture content of corrugated board and reduce the degree of interference of corrugated board by the environment is a very complicated and very important task.
1. Corrugated cardboard failure caused by water content
Failure caused by high water content:
Corrugated, unglued paper edges on the double-sided machine, excessive cracks on the slitting edge, corrugated damage, obvious unbonded stripes (dry stripes) on corrugated cardboard, longitudinal warpage of corrugated cardboard, uneven corrugated forming, etc.
Failure caused by too low water content: excessive slits on the slitting edge, corrugated cracks, running corrugations, uneven corrugated forming, etc.
Failure caused by uneven moisture distribution: corrugated cardboard surface and corrugated top, corrugated wrinkles, horizontal warpage of corrugated cardboard, longitudinal warpage of corrugated cardboard, S-shaped (composite) warpage of corrugated cardboard, uneven flute, uneven corrugated forming .
Second, the main factors affecting the moisture content of corrugated cardboard (box)
The production process of corrugated cardboard is relatively complicated, and its moisture content is affected by many factors, which can be summarized as the following:
(1) The moisture content of the base paper used in the production of paperboard. According to the national standard, the moisture content of the base paper in the delivery state is generally 9% to 12%. Whether the moisture content of the base paper meets the standard will directly affect the production process of corrugated cardboard and whether its moisture content meets the production requirements.
(2) Drying at the preheating drum. The function of the preheating roller is to evaporate the moisture of the base paper that is put into production and make its moisture uniform. It plays a role in adjusting the moisture of the base paper.
(3) Characteristics of paper raw materials and glue. If the fiber structure of some core paper or corrugated paper is loose, or the viscosity of the glue is poor, the moisture content of the cardboard is high.
(4) The influence of the drying and cooling process after the cardboard is bonded. When drying, the temperature of the oven is low, the production speed is fast, the heat absorbed by the corrugated cardboard is insufficient, the drying is slow, and the moisture content is high, which makes the adhesive of the cardboard paste and curing incomplete, reducing the strength, otherwise, the moisture content is low.
(5) The impact of the production environment. Mainly include the temperature, humidity and ventilation effect of the production workshop.
(6) The influence of the circulation environment. Corrugated boxes are very easily affected by the circulation environment during use. The moisture and temperature of the circulation environment will have a direct impact on the moisture content of the corrugated boxes, which in turn will affect the performance and service life of the corrugated boxes.
3. The main ways of moisture control of corrugated board
The national standard for the moisture content of corrugated cardboard is 11 ± 3%. In order to ensure carton production, good printing, firm adhesion, smooth trimming, strong resistance to pressure, reduce waste, improve labor productivity, and increase the economic benefits of enterprises, it is necessary to start from raw materials, The production process, equipment environment and other aspects have taken effective measures to control the moisture content of the corrugated board, keep it within the standard range, and ensure the production quality of the corrugated board. Therefore, the main methods of corrugated board moisture control are:
(1) Strictly control the moisture content of raw paper entering the factory. According to the provisions of national standards, the moisture content of the base paper in the delivery state is generally 9% to 12%. First of all, in the purchase of base paper, the quality should be well controlled, and the moisture content of the base paper entering the factory should be strictly checked, and the supplier should be required to supply qualified base paper. In addition, the original paper storage must set up a separate warehouse, the temperature is generally 15 ℃ ~ 20 ℃, the relative humidity is generally 30% to 40%. Do not put it in the open air, as this will easily cause changes in the moisture content of the base paper, and cause inconsistencies in the moisture content at both ends and in the middle, which will cause greater troubles for future processing.
(2) Temperature is one of the decisive factors affecting the quality of corrugated cardboard. Reasonable temperature control should be carried out during the production of corrugated cardboard. The temperature can not only adjust the moisture content of the base paper, but also affect the temperature of the base paper, so that the paste can be cured in a reasonable time. Therefore, many preheaters and drying boards are installed on the corrugated cardboard production line to adjust the moisture content of the base paper and single-sided cardboard, and to solidify the paste, and to adhere the corrugated cardboard layers. Normally, when the vehicle speed is above 100m / min, the curing temperature of the paste is 160 ℃ ~ 180 ℃, that is to say, the pressure of the saturated steam of the boiler should reach 0.9Mpa ~ 1.4Mpa. The temperature control mainly includes the temperature control of the preheating drum, the temperature control of the dryer, and the temperature control of the hydrophobic device.
(3) Reasonably adjust the quality of the paste, the amount of paste, the size, thinness, and thickness of the amount of water. If the amount of paste water is large, the paste is thin and penetrates quickly, the moisture content of the cardboard is high, otherwise the moisture content is small. When the amount of paste is large, the moisture content of the cardboard is large; the amount of paste is small, the moisture content is small. Therefore, the paste should be prepared strictly in accordance with the amount of water and the ratio of the paste and the stirring time, and the viscosity of the paste should be mastered.
(4) Carry out anti-water and moisturizing treatment on corrugated cardboard. First, prepare a water-resistant humectant emulsion, use the principle of energy balance to penetrate into the paper fiber material, and form a protective film on its surface, using the spray system to achieve its surface tension, surface free energy and solid-liquid attachment work , And then achieve the balance between emulsion penetration and film formation. The corrugated packaging board with water resistance and moisturizing properties is produced without affecting printing.
(5) By coating paraffin, silicone, varnish and other hydrophobic agents on the surface of corrugated cardboard, the corrugated cardboard has a hydrophobic function. Water-repellent corrugated paperboard is also called water-repellent corrugated paperboard. When it is exposed to water for a short time, the processed surface of the paperboard makes the water splash into water droplets and prevents water from seeping into the interior of the paperboard. The hydrophobic corrugated cardboard is suitable for packaging dry powdery articles, especially powders that are easy to agglomerate after absorbing water, and is also suitable for packaging commodities that often enter and exit the cold storage. It is easy to dew on the wall of the box after being taken out of the cold storage, and ordinary corrugated cardboard will quickly absorb The reduction of the compressive strength causes the carton to be crushed by the stacking pressure. The cardboard after the hydrophobic processing will not significantly reduce the compressive strength before the dewdrop evaporates, which can effectively protect the goods.
(6) The molten synthetic resin or paraffin mixture flows down from the hopper mouth into a film and is coated on corrugated cardboard running horizontally. A resin film or wax film is formed on the surface of the cardboard, which has good water-blocking performance. If necessary, circulate the film once on the other side in order to obtain double-sided waterproof performance, so that the corrugated cardboard has water resistance. Waterproof (water-retaining) corrugated cardboard is also called water-shielding corrugated cardboard. Its surface is almost impermeable to water for a long time, but it cannot be immersed in water, otherwise it will lose its waterproof performance.
(7) Using special technology to make corrugated cardboard with strong water resistance. Corrugated paperboard is soaked in water for a long time after processing, and the strength is not greatly reduced is called strong water-resistant corrugated paperboard. There are two commonly used manufacturing methods. One is the primary processing method: that is, the base paper is endowed with water resistance during the papermaking stage; and the secondary processing method: the processing method that is endowed with water resistance in the corrugated board manufacturing stage.
The one-time processing method is a method of combining water-resistant linerboard and water-resistant corrugated base paper and then using water-resistant adhesives to make corrugated board after processing. Since the water resistance of the base paper with water resistance is divided into medium water resistance and high water resistance, the corrugated cardboard produced also has two kinds of medium water resistance and high water resistance.
There are two secondary processing methods: coating method and dipping method:
The coating method refers to installing a roll coating machine on the corrugated board machine, applying paraffin to the liner board and the corrugated board, and then bonding. After applying the adhesive on one side of the corrugated base paper before it enters the hot plate, spray the waterproof coating on the corrugated base paper; sometimes in order to improve the water resistance of the corrugated board end surface, the corrugated board machine must be Spray water-proof paint on the incisions at both ends.
The dipping method is to make the paperboard pass through the dipping tank of molten waterproof paint, so that the waterproof paint soaks the surface of the paper, and then send the paperboard to the drying section, which is heated by hot air above 105 ° C to allow the paperboard surface to absorb the waterproof paint. It will be fixed on the surface of the cardboard to make the cardboard have good waterproofness. Using the impregnation method When the additional amount of impregnation of the waterproof coating reaches 40% to 50% of the weight of the base paper used, the strength of the paperboard can be greatly improved, but when it is used for general linerboard, the color of the paperboard will become black.
